We have developed a coarse-grained model for the aqueous solution of an acrylic copolymer and a surfactant. We use the method of dissipative particle dynamics [1-3]. Electric charges on surfactant molecules and counter-ions are taken into account explicitly, and we use for electrostatic interactions the computational scheme developed in Ref.[2]. The aim is to study the structure and to perform the analysis of stability of micelles in polymer/surfactant solutions, as well as to search for optimal conditions of a film formation from aqueous solutions of polymer micelles stabilized by surfactants. To model the film formation we apply an algorithm for evaporation of the solvent (water). As an illustration of the capabilities of the computational scheme, we demonstrate our results of the influence of various parameters of the model (concentration of components, parameters of volume interaction and of electrostatic interaction) on the characteristics of the emerging films.
